Inclusion Criteria:
1. Adult patients (≥18 years). 2. Confirmed diagnosis with MBC. 3. HR-positive/HER2-negative MBC as ascertained by immunohistochemistry (IHC) or fluorescence in situ hybridization in primary or metastatic tissue samples.
4. Patients with primary or secondary resistance to endocrine therapy. 5. Patients with Eastern Cooperative Oncology Group (ECOG) 0 or 1. 6. Scheduled to receive Palbociclib in first- or second-line metastatic setting.
Exclusion Criteria:
- Prior exposure to fulvestrant or everolimus.
- Patients with uncontrolled brain metastases or symptomatic visceral spread who are at risk of life-threatening complications.
- Patients refusing to sign the written informed consent.

Primary resistant to endocrine therapy
Primary endocrine resistance is defined as a relapse within 2 years of adjuvant endocrine treatment or disease progression during the first 6 months of first-line endocrine therapy for advanced or MBC

Secondary resistant to endocrine therapy
Secondary resistance is defined in early BC as a relapse that occurs after at least 2 years of endocrine therapy and during or within the first year of completing adjuvant endocrine therapy.
In advanced BC or MBC, secondary resistance is defined as disease progression after more than 6 months of endocrine therapy
